Attorney tangled in fraud and corruption case to appear in Pretoria court
Updated | By Andrew Robertson
A Pretoria attorney is expected to appear in court today for his alleged role in a massive SAPS fraud and corruption case.

The 32-year-old man from Centurion handed himself over to the Anti Corruption Task Team yesterday.
The case related to a 2018 investigation of alleged fraud and corruption of SAPS vehicles' branding, renovation of buildings, and the procurement of stationery.
His arrest brings the total number of accused to 72 accused. These include top cops and business people.

National police spokesperson Vishnu Naidoo. " He's alleged to have received over R900 000 from one of the accused on the day the said accused was being arrested. Naidoo is expected to appear in the Pretoria Magistrates court tomorrow for a formal bail application.
More arrests in connection with these cases cannot be ruled out at this stage.
